How they compare
East Asia & Pacific currently reports 38.80 million against 7.30 million in Mozambique, a difference of 31.50 million.
That makes East Asia & Pacific's figure about 5.3 times Mozambique's.
Across all 23 years both countries report, East Asia & Pacific has been ahead every year.
East Asia & Pacific ranks 23rd and Mozambique ranks 20th of 42 groups.
East Asia & Pacific has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| East Asia & Pacific | Mozambique |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 192.11 million | 5.88 million | 186.23 million | East Asia & Pacific |
| 2010s | 66.06 million | 8.03 million | 58.03 million | East Asia & Pacific |
| 2020s | 40.80 million | 7.40 million | 33.40 million | East Asia & Pacific |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Number of people who are undernourished shows the number of people whose habitual food consumption is insufficient to provide the dietary energy levels that are required to maintain a normal active and healthy life.
